Guillaume Lejean

1 books

Guillaume Lejean was a 19th-century writer known for his travel literature, particularly his work "Reize in Taka (Opper-Nubië) / De Aarde en haar Volken," published in 1873. In this book, Lejean explores the geography, cultures, and peoples of Upper Nubia, providing readers with a detailed account of his experiences and observations. His writing reflects a keen interest in the diverse landscapes and societies he encountered, contributing to the understanding of the region during a time of significant exploration and colonial interest. Lejean's work remains a valuable resource for those interested in historical travel narratives and the cultural dynamics of the areas he visited.
